No borders for innovations: A ca. 2700-year-old Assyrian-style leather scale armour in Northwest China

The first millennium BCE was pivotal for the environment and human societies in Central Eastern Eurasia because transformations accelerated altered natural cultural landscapes to hitherto unknown dimensions. Among major driving forces increasing use of horse riding, which extended range movement significantly led development cavalry units as a part large armies. Empires with enormous outreach gravitational pull formed disintegrated close dependence. wide spread military technologies demonstrates their bonds, though mostly form metal objects due inherent survivability materials. Equipment protective clothing organic material, albeit produced numbers thus an economic environmental factor, are rarely preserved. In Yanghai cemetery site, Turfan, remains one leather scale armour were discovered. this study, results AMS radiocarbon dating well construction details find presented compared contemporary origin Metropolitan Museum Art New York (MET) finds depictions from Near East, adjacent northern steppe areas territory China. armour, datable 786–543 cal (95% probability), originally made about 5444 smaller scales 140 larger scales, which, together laces lining, had total weight ca. 4–5 kg. Our reconstruction that it can be donned quickly without help another person by wrapping left around back, tying right under arm fastening thongs crosswise over back at opposite hip parts. Fitting different statures, is light highly efficient defensive garment. age, aesthetic appearance resembles MET armour. stylistic similarities but constructional differences suggest two armours intended outfits distinct same army, i.e. heavy infantry, respectively. As such high level standardization equipment during 7th century only known Neo-Assyrian forces, we place manufacture both Empire. If supposition correct, then rare actual proofs West-East technology transfer across Eurasian continent half BCE, when social transformation enhanced.
